Gross enrolment ratio, primary and lower secondary, male in Croatia
Croatia: Gross enrolment ratio, primary and lower secondary, male was 101.2% in 2018. ▲ Rising
Gross enrolment ratio, primary and lower secondary, male in Croatia, 1996–2018
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
Croatia recorded 101.2% for gross enrolment ratio, primary and lower secondary, male in 2018.
That represents a change of down 1.2% on the previous year and up 0.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io, primary and lower secondary, male in Croatia peaked at 103.3% in 2005 and was at its lowest, 85.4%, in 1996.
Croatia ranks 97th of 188 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.

About this data
Total male enrollment in primary and lower secondary education, regardless of age, expressed as a percentage of the male population of official primary and lower secondary education age. GER can exceed 100% due to the inclusion of over-aged and under-aged students because of early or late school entrance and grade repetition.
